Hugo Russell

Gift Shop in London

  • Gift Shop icon Gift Shop
  • London icon London
Visit Website
Icon for calling Hugo Russell 020 8992 1114

About Hugo Russell

Unique gifts for the special person in your life. Hugo Russell gift shop in London has something for everyone.


Own this business? Call us on 0333 014 8550 to unlock your full listing's potential.

You can create an account to leave a review

Signup is fast, easy and we don't send you marketing emails.

Register